Output 842974c59da67970b77dd2d50bf68cfec816c9f8f42537e3296aa65d3a60f945:1

value
66295553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b680e9189c0ba954c7c2ed7b688f591c12ce79 OP_EQUAL
address
3JFprqMUVYENuhTtA8bdArXegmhTMTzDXJ
transaction
842974c59da67970b77dd2d50bf68cfec816c9f8f42537e3296aa65d3a60f945
spent
true